Join me in discovering the most iconic places in La Paz. We’ll start at the Witches’ Market, a place full of magic and tradition. Then, we’ll head to the fascinating Coca Museum, where we’ll explore the history and significance of this sacred plant. Next, we’ll visit the historic Plaza Murillo, the political heart of the city, reliving key moments in Bolivia’s history. We’ll then ride the modern Mi Teleférico,cable car, offering spectacular views of the city’s stunning landscape, nestled between mountains and valleys. Our journey will culminate at the breathtaking Valley of the Moon, a one-of-a-kind landscape that looks like something from another world. Guided by local and indigenous Aymara and Quechua people, this tour will allow us to immerse ourselves in their rich history, culture, and spirituality from an authentic, deep, and unforgettable perspective. ✨ Includes: Pickup from hotel, Airbnb, or place of stay, transportation, tickets, water, and more. ⏰ Flexible schedule.
